如何实现“rpop redis”
整体流程
首先,让我们来看一下实现“rpop redis”的整体流程:
journey
title 整体流程
section 开始
开始 --> 查询redis中的数据: 查询
section 查询数据
查询 --> 弹出最后一个元素: 弹出
section 结束
弹出 --> 结束: 完成
每一步具体操作
查询redis中的数据
在这一步,我们需要查询redis中的数据,然后可以获取到最后一个元素。
```python
# 连接redis
import redis
r = redis.Redis(host='localhost', port=6379, db=0)
# 查询redis中的列表数据
data = r.lrange('list_key', 0, -1)
print(data)
```python
弹出最后一个元素
在这一步,我们需要弹出redis列表中的最后一个元素。
```python
# 弹出最后一个元素
last_element = r.rpop('list_key')
print(last_element)
```python
类图
下面是实现“rpop redis”所需要使用的类图:
classDiagram
class Redis {
+ Redis(host, port, db)
+ lrange(key, start, end)
+ rpop(key)
}
总结
通过以上步骤,你就可以成功实现“rpop redis”操作了。希望这篇文章对你有所帮助,如果有任何问题,请随时向我提问。加油!